We call ourselves 'Chavalos Nica'. In English this means 'Nica Kids'. We are children of the poor of Nicaragua. Our families are poor. Our houses are not fine or big. Many of our mothers have no stove, and cook our meals with wood fires outside the house. Some of us have no electricity in our house, and some have no bathroom inside the house. Many of our parents earn less than $1 a day.

But we are more than all of that. We are children of God, and believe He has called us together in a group with a lifetime committment to make Nicaragua better. Together we study the Bible, share God's Word with other kids and adults, give away lots of Bibles, and go to school, and work hard on our English.
We are preparing to make a new revolution in Nicaragua, not with guns but with education, and with the power of our knowledge of God's Word.
Education is a big problem because public schools in Nicaragua are ineffective, and do not prepare you to be an educated adult.
